SEARCH FOR THE DIRECTOR OF ADMISSIONS
D’Youville College (Buffalo, NY) invites nominations, inquiries, and applications for the position of Director of Admissions. Reporting to the Vice President of Institutional Advancement, the Director will be responsible for undergraduate and graduate admissions and will work collaboratively to design and implement institution-wide recruitment and enrollment strategies. D’Youville seeks an innovative and visionary leader to bring an understanding of the trends, best practices, and data-driven approaches of strategic recruitment in higher education to lead in crafting and implementing an effective institutional enrollment plan for regional, national and international recruitment. The new Director is expected to take office in late spring/early summer.

About D’Youville College
Founded in 1908, D’Youville College is an MSCHE-accredited, independent Catholic college located in the city of Buffalo, New York. D’Youville offers its 3,000 students preeminent education in undergraduate, graduate and professional degree programs in allied health professions, education, business, and liberal arts.
D’Youville’s success is built on the commitment that our students learn how to think critically, work with others, be leaders, and communicate effectively – all skills employers look for in the people they hire. D’Youville is an exceptionally collegial and exciting place to work and learn. Its motivating plan for the future and expanded outreach to the region, state, nation and global community provide wonderful opportunities.
D’Youville is situated in the Prospect Park/Lower West Side neighborhood, one of Buffalo’s most diverse and historic neighborhoods with fine examples of residential architecture from the last hundred years. The city is in the midst of a remarkable transformation, including a redeveloped waterfront and revitalized neighborhoods. Buffalo is home to several Frank Lloyd Wright buildings, Frederick Law Olmstead parks, and of course, the chicken wing!
